Health checks for the Marrowgate API run behind the Tindel balancer. Probe path is /healthz; it must return within 2s or the node drains. Liveness and readiness are separate — do not merge them again. Drained nodes rejoin only after three consecutive passes. The balancer reads probe behavior from the service config, listed here.

config for kafof-bawef:
holath:
  log_level: debug
  metrics_host: metrics.holath.qorvelsys.internal
  pin: 2191
  pool_size: 32

### Runbook: Report export timezone mismatches (Glimmerfield)

If a customer reports that exported totals differ from the dashboard, check whether their report schedule predates the March cutover — older schedules still render in server-local time rather than the account timezone. Re-saving the schedule fixes it. Before escalating, confirm the export worker is running with the expected timezone settings shown below.

config for kadup-kajog:
[raldor]
host = raldor.tolvaqworks.internal
user = raldor_svc
database = raldor_prod

Ticket: Config drift in Flagwright rollout framework

Welcome aboard. Since you're new to the Flagwright stack at Pellenor Systems, quick context: the staging and production flag-evaluation services have drifted. Someone hand-edited staging's rollout percentages back in March, and the declarative manifests were never updated, so redeploys keep flip-flopping values. Your task is to reconcile staging against the source-of-truth manifest and re-enable the drift checker. For reference, the current production values are captured below.

deployment values, bahof-badug:
[rusix]
team = zorok
access_code = ac_641cbe
owner = ulair.tamius
host = rusix.torvasoft.local
port = 5672
peer = ulaix.sivrelworks.internal
salt = 1df570ed
pin = 6327

Q: Why are users being logged out of Fernwick every 15 minutes?
A: A refresh bug in the Sessionly token service drops renewals under load. A patch ships Friday. Until then, support staff can manually extend sessions via the Opsgate console, which requires the team recovery passphrase. It is:

strongbox words: zorox-holix